12

gVim 中是否有功能、插件或方法来显示匹配搜索词的标记,指出它们在缓冲区中的大致位置?例如,当在缓冲区中搜索“foo”时,该功能会将标记与垂直滚动条一起放置。每个标记表示一个匹配的“foo”。当您滚动到该位置时,您会在缓冲区中看到一个“foo”。有了这个功能,我可以很容易地直观地分辨出术语的分布模式,当前术语在文档中的相对位置以及大约出现了多少次。

如果没有这样的功能,有没有办法在插件中操作 gVim 的滚动条和其他 GUI 组件?

在 Firefox 中,类似的功能由Search Marker(过时)、XUL/Migemo(过时)或FindBar Tweak(最新)扩展完成。

更新:


(来源:Mozilla.net


(来源:Mozilla.net

4

2 回答 2

2

如果您想查看分布,您可以尝试:

:g//#

这将显示找到搜索模式的行。

于 2011-02-19T13:31:45.997 回答
1

尝试:set hlsearch获得突出显示的搜索词。

也可以尝试按下来^G查看光标所在的行和列。

于 2011-02-16T22:37:57.103 回答